It is the philosophy of Ridgeview Classical Schools that all students benefit from a rigorous, content-rich, educational program that develops academic potential and personal character. The school provides an environment that fosters academic excellence through the habits of thoroughness, the willingness to work, and the perseverance to complete difficult tasks. Through a defined traditional, Classical-Liberal curriculum students are prepared to become active, responsible members of their community. Ridgeview Classical Schools is a free, public K-12 Charter School, chartered through the Poudre School District. The school opened in 2001, has high school grades 9-12, and has open enrollment through a lottery system. |
